ORDER : The Court made the following order :- The petitioners/A2 to A4, who were arrested and remanded to judicial custody on 07.11.2022 for the offences punishable under Sections 294(b), 323, 307 and 506(ii) of IPC, in crime No.264 of 2022 on the file of the respondent police, seek bail. 1/4

2.The case of the prosecution is that due to previous enmity with regard to the temple festival on 06.11.2022, the petitioners and the other accused said to have abused the defacto complainant in filthy language and attacked him with aruval and caused injury to him. Hence, the complaint.

3.The learned counsel for the petitioners would submit that the petitioners are innocents and they have been falsely implicated in this case. He would further submit that the injured was discharged from the hospital and they are in judicial custody from 07.11.2022 and hence, he may be granted bail.

4.The learned Additional Public Prosecutor would submit that totally 4 accused are involved in this case. The petitioners were arrayed as A2 to A4. A1 was detained under Act 14. He would further submit that the injured was discharged from the hospital. However, A2 is having 8 previous cases, A3 is having 3 previous cases and A4 is having 1 previous case. Hence, he strongly opposed to grant bail to the petitioner.

5.Considering the period of incarceration and also considering the fact that the injured was discharged from the hospital, this Court is inclined to grant bail to the petitioners on certain conditions.

6.Accordingly, this Criminal Original Petition is allowed and the petitioners are ordered to be released on bail, on executing a bond for a sum of Rs.10,000/- (Rupees Ten Thousand only) each with two sureties each for a like sum to the satisfaction of the learned (*)Judicial Magistrate No.III, Tirunelveli.

(i)the sureties shall affix their photographs and left thumb impression in the surety bond and the Magistrate/concerned court may obtain a copy of their Aadhar card or Bank Pass Book to ensure their identity;

(ii)the petitioners shall report before the Virudhunagar Bazaar Police Station daily at 10.30 a.m., until further orders; (iii)the petitioners shall not tamper with evidence or witness; iv)the petitioners shall not abscond during trial. v)On breach of any of the aforesaid conditions, the learned Magistrate/Trial Court is entitled to take appropriate action against the petitioners in accordance with law as if the conditions have been imposed and the petitioners released on bail by the learned Magistrate/Trial Court himself as laid down by the Hon'ble Supreme Court in P.K.Shaji vs. State of Kerala [(2005)AIR SCW 5560]. 2/4

vi)If the accused thereafter abscond, a fresh FIR can be registered under Section 229A IPC.
